Understanding the Dangers of Welding Fumes
When you melt metal, you aren’t just creating a weld bead; you are creating a complex cocktail of airborne contaminants. These range from metal oxides—like manganese, chromium, and nickel—to shielding gases and ozone.
These particles are often so fine that they bypass your body’s natural defenses. Over time, inhaling these substances leads to respiratory issues that no DIYer wants to deal with.
Ignoring these risks is a common pitfall in home garages where ventilation is often subpar. Even if you are just doing a quick repair on a gate, those few minutes of exposure add up over a lifetime of tinkering.
Types of Welding Respiratory Protective Equipment
When searching for the right gear, you will find a range of options that cater to different budgets and welding processes. Choosing the right welding respiratory protective equipment is about matching the level of protection to the specific hazards you face.
Disposable Particulate Respirators
These are the common N95 or P100 masks you see at the hardware store. They are affordable and effective for occasional, short-term welding projects.
However, they must fit perfectly against your face to be effective. If you have facial hair, these masks will fail to provide a proper seal, leaving you vulnerable to fumes.
Half-Mask Reusable Respirators
These offer a much better seal than disposable masks and use replaceable filter cartridges. Many metalworkers prefer these because they fit comfortably under most welding helmets.
Look for cartridges specifically rated for welding fumes and ozone. Remember to swap your filters regularly; if you notice a smell or increased breathing resistance, it is time for a fresh set.
Powered Air Purifying Respirators (PAPR)
A PAPR is the gold standard for professional-grade protection. It uses a battery-powered fan to push filtered air into a head-top unit, creating a positive pressure environment.
Because the air is forced in, you don’t need a tight face seal. This is a game-changer for those with beards or anyone who spends hours at the welding bench.
Proper Fit Testing and Maintenance
Buying the gear is only half the battle. If your mask doesn’t fit, it’s just a piece of plastic taking up space in your toolbox.
Perform a seal check every single time you put your respirator on. Cover the intake valves with your hands and inhale gently; the mask should collapse slightly toward your face.
If you feel air leaking around the edges, adjust your straps. If it still leaks, you likely need a different size or brand that fits your specific face shape better.
When Ventilation Alone Isn’t Enough
Many hobbyists rely solely on an open garage door or a box fan to clear the air. While moving air is important, it rarely removes the toxic fumes at the source.
Cross-ventilation is a great start, but it doesn’t protect you while your face is inches away from the arc. Always use local exhaust ventilation if you have it, but don’t use it as an excuse to skip your personal respirator.
Think of your respirator as your last line of defense. Even with a high-end fume extractor, you should still wear your protection to catch what the vacuum misses.
Selecting the Right Filters for Your Process
Not all welding creates the same hazards. Welding stainless steel, for example, releases hexavalent chromium, which requires a much higher level of filtration than mild steel.
Always check the safety data sheet (SDS) for the materials you are using. This document will tell you exactly what kind of fumes are generated and what type of protection is recommended.
When in doubt, go for a higher-rated filter. It is better to have “too much” protection than to find out years later that your filter wasn’t up to the task.
Frequently Asked Questions About Welding Respiratory Protective Equipment
Can I wear a standard dust mask for welding?
No. Standard dust masks are designed for large particles like sawdust or concrete dust. They do not filter out the ultra-fine metal fumes and gases produced during welding. Always use a mask rated for welding fumes, typically labeled as P100.
How often should I replace my respirator filters?
Replace your filters when you notice increased difficulty in breathing or if you detect an odor while welding. Even if they seem clean, follow the manufacturer’s guidelines for service life, as internal filter media degrades over time.
Do I need a respirator if I am welding outdoors?
Outdoor welding is significantly safer than indoor welding due to natural air movement. However, if you are welding in a confined space or in a position where fumes blow directly into your face, you should still wear a respirator.
Will a respirator fit under my welding helmet?
Most low-profile half-mask respirators are designed to fit under standard welding helmets. If you find it too bulky, look for “slim-profile” or “low-profile” models specifically marketed for welding.
